RSA 301-A:5 · Organization Certificate
301-A:5 Organization Certificate. – Before a cooperative association may begin its activities, the president, treasurer, and a majority of the directors shall prepare, subscribe to, and file with the secretary of state a certificate of organization containing:
Copy linkThe names and addresses of the directors who shall manage the affairs of the association for the first year, unless sooner changed by the members.
Copy linkA statement of whether the association is organized with or without shares, and the number of subscribed for shares or memberships.
Copy linkIf organized with shares, a statement of the amount of authorized capital, the number and types of shares and the par value thereof which may be placed at any figure, and the rights, preferences, and restrictions of each type of share.
Copy linkThe minimum number or value of shares which must be owned in order to qualify for membership; if organized without shares, a statement of whether the property rights of members shall be equal or unequal, and if unequal, the rule by which their rights shall be determined.
Copy linkThe maximum amount or percentage of capital which may be owned or controlled by any member; including a statement of whether or not each member shall be limited to a single share, and whether such single shares shall be of various par values.
Copy linkThe method by which any surplus, upon dissolution of the association, shall be distributed, in conformity with the requirements of RSA 301-A:33.
Copy linkThe articles may also contain any other provisions not inconsistent with law or with this chapter, for the conduct of the association's affairs. Source. 1983, 462:1, eff. July 1, 1983.
